tvpham: The Westin Ka'anapali Ocean Resort Villas
tvpham: Makaluapuna Point
tvpham: Makaluapuna Point
tvpham: Dragon's Teeth Labyrinth
tvpham: Makaluapuna Point
tvpham: Makaluapuna Point
tvpham: Makaluapuna Point
tvpham: Makaluapuna Point
tvpham: Dragon's Teeth
tvpham: Dragon's Teeth
tvpham: Home Maid Bakery
tvpham: Malasadas
tvpham: Blowhole at La Perouse Bay
tvpham: Underwater
tvpham: The Westin Ka'anapali Ocean Resort Villas
tvpham: Inside a Whale's Mouth
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center
tvpham: Maui Ocean Center